STRUCTURE, GOVERNANCE AND MANAGEMENT

The Charity governing document is a declaration of trust that was executed 1[ST] September 2011 .The Charity is governed by a board on which the trustees are represented. It meets regularly to review, plan activities and monitor the financial position.

OBJECTIVES AND ACTIVITIES

The Objects of the organisation are first to advance the Christian faith in accordance with the statement of beliefs for the benefit in the United Kingdom and in such other parts of the world as the trustees may think fit from time to time . The trustees confirm that they have had due regard to the guidance issued by the Charity Commission on public benefit before deciding what activities the charity should undertake.

ACHIEVMENTS AND PERFORMANCE

The Organisation continues to hold successful worship services through the year in which individuals were equipped and educated on the principles and doctrines of the Christian faith. The organisation due to the pandemic had to hold all of its services and meetings online..

2

FINANCIAL REVIEW

The income of the charity is above £26,000. Though this is a lower amount for this year of the charity than last year, the costs have been well managed over this period. The organisation is still in a good position to manage its costs. The organisation main costs are for the hall hire and the building it uses for its offices.

RESERVE POLICY

It is the policy of the Charity to maintain unrestricted funds, which are the reserves of the charity at about 3 months of unrestricted expenditure .This provides sufficient funds to cover any emergency expenditures that may arise from time to time. The charity will seek to maintain this level throughout the year.

TRINITY BAPTIST CHURCH NEW ADDINGTON NOTES TO THE ACCOUNTS FOR THE YEAR ENDED 31[ST] DECEMBER 2020

1) Accounting Policies

The financial statements have been prepared in accordance with Accounting and Reporting by Charities: Statement of Recommended Practice applicable to charities preparing their accounts in accordance with the Financial Reporting Standard for Smaller Entities published on 16/07/14, the Financial Reporting Standard for Smaller Entities (effective January 2015). Assets and liabilities are initially recognised at historical cost or transaction value unless otherwise stated in the relevant accounting policy note(s)

Incoming Resources

Incoming resources are recognised in the statement of financial activities when entitlement has passed to the charity and the amounts are certain and measurable. Any incoming resources received that relate exclusively to future periods are Deferred on the Balance Sheet

Resources Expended

Expenditure is recognised in the statement of financial activities when a liability is incurred or increased without a commensurate increase in recognised assets or a reduction in liabilities.

Allocation of Costs

Direct Activity Costs comprise those costs that contribute directly to an activity and are allocated to the relevant activity

Support Costs comprise those costs that are necessary to deliver an activity but in themselves do not produce or deliver an activity. Support costs are allocated to activities based on the direct salary costs of the activity compared with total activity salary costs

Funds

Restricted funds represent income received that is subject to restrictions on use as determined by the donor which are narrower than the general objects. Designated funds represent funds set aside by the Trustees for specific purposes General funds are those funds made available for the charity’s general objects.

Depreciation

Items of equipment over £500 are capitalised and depreciated so as to write off Cost in equal instalments over their useful lives. Rates are set at equipment 5 to 10 years.
